摘要:MySQL中的空函数可以提高数据查询的效率,但是正确使用空函数也是非常重要的。本文将为大家介绍MySQL空函数的正确使用方法,帮助大家更好地利用空函数来提高数据查询的效率。
一、什么是MySQL空函数?
MySQL空函数指的是在SQL语句中使用的一种特殊函数,其作用是返回一个空值。MySQL中常用的空函数有:NULL、IS NULL、IFNULL、COALESCE等。
二、为什么要使用MySQL空函数?
使用MySQL空函数可以提高数据查询的效率,因为在查询数据时,经常需要判断某些列是否为空,使用MySQL空函数可以快速地判断出某列是否为空,从而提高查询效率。
三、MySQL空函数的正确使用方法
1. NULL函数
NULL函数的作用是返回一个空值。在MySQL中,NULL函数可以用于给某个列赋空值。例如:
n = NULL WHERE id = 1;
2. IS NULL函数
IS NULL函数的作用是判断某个列是否为空值。例如:
n IS NULL;
3. IFNULL函数
IFNULL函数的作用是判断某个列是否为空值,如果为空,则返回指定的默认值。例如:
n, 'default_value') FROM table;
4. COALESCE函数
COALESCE函数的作用是从多个列中选择一个非空值。例如:
n1n2n3) FROM table;
以上就是MySQL空函数的正确使用方法,希望本文对大家有所帮助,让大家能够更好地利用MySQL空函数来提高数据查询的效率。